If you've ever had a crash, your healing progress is verly likely scattered across the gallery on your phone. Mine was. So I wrote an iOS app to organize the photos and notes for each of the wounds/scratches from crashing my bike. It's been helpful to crop and save photos per-wound, and take notes on how often I'm changing the bandages out. In the end, writing the app while stuck in bed gave me some sense of control over a situation that I ultimately have minimal influence on: healing.
I "sideloaded" it onto my iPhone 15 Pro Max after jumping through all of Apple's insane hoops to do so, and apparently it will still need to be rebuilt weekly. Very frustrating that I can't push this to the app store without a $99/year developer license!
